In 2020-2021, 20,056 people earned their degree in general chemistry, making the major the 43rd most popular in the United States.

Across Alabama, there were 316 general chemistry gra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the bachelor’s degree level specifically, there were 261 general chemistry graduates with average earnings and debt of $37,756 and $28,178 respectively.

This year’s “Schools for a Bachelor’s Highly Focused on Chemistry Major in Alabama” ranking looked at 22 colleges that offer degrees in a bachelor’s in general chemistry. This a ranking of the schools where the largest percentage of students has enrolled in general chemistry.
